2017-04-13 103 views
0

我試圖寫一個檢查字符串中的正則表達式語句滿足以下:多個正則表達式來檢查字符串

以三個零,後面是最多四個字母,隨後是一破折號後跟八個小寫字母或數字,另一個短劃線,然後是abcd或kys後綴。

^[0]{3}[-](?=.*?[a-z])(?=.*?[0-9]).{8,}[-]([ab][cd][kys]) 

我對如何分解八個字符部分和suffex部分有點困惑。有人能指引我朝着正確的方向嗎?

+1

你能後一對夫婦的好的和壞的字符串的例子嗎? – tdelaney

+0

這是任何unicode小寫字母還是a-z? – tdelaney

回答

1

我認爲你需要這樣的:

^[0]{3}[a-zA-Z]{,4}\-[a-z0-9]{8}\-((ab)|(cd)|(kys))$ 
+0

謝謝,我現在看看這些陳述是如何工作的。 – alienmode

相關問題